Civics for All of US is the new national civic education initiative from the Gerald R. Ford Presidential Library and Museum and the National Archives.Our mission is to build civic literacy and engagement by providing exemplary civic education resources and programs for all ages using the records of the U.S. Government. Civics for All of US delivers thought-provoking educational programs and powerful educational resources to the public, regardless of their proximity to a National Archives facility. Each program is led by one of our educators located at National Archives sites, the Center for Legislative Archives, and Presidential Libraries across the country.

Current Offerings

Live, interactive distance learning programs are available for groups of 10 or more students free of charge. Programs take a hands-on approach to the founding documents of the United States, using the holdings of the National Archives to explore the big ideas of the Constitution and Bill of Rights and promoting the knowledge and skills students need for civic engagement in the 21st century.
